Study of Durvalumab+Olaparib or Durvalumab After Treatment With Durvalumab and Chemotherapy in Patients With Lung Cancer (ORION)

Summary

This is a randomized, double-blind, multi-center, global Phase II study to determine the efficacy and safety of Durvalumab plus Olaparib combination therapy compared with Durvalumab monotherapy as maintenance therapy in patients whose disease has not progressed following Standard of Care (SoC) platinum-based chemotherapy with Durvalumab as first-line treatment in patients with Stage IV non small-cell lung cancer (NSCLC) with tumors that lack activating epidermal growth factor receptor (EGFR) mutations and anaplastic lymphoma kinase (ALK) fusions.

Interventions

DRUG

Durvalumab

Initial therapy phase: IV infusion q3w for 4 cycles. Maintenance phase: IV infusion q4w.

DRUG

Placebo for Olaparib

Matching tablet

DRUG

Olaparib

150-mg tablets (2 × 150-mg tablets for 300-mg dose) 100-mg tablet available if dose reductions are required

DRUG

Nab-paclitaxel+carboplatin

Standard of Care chemotherapy (squamous and non-squamous patients)

DRUG

Gemcitabine+carboplatin

Standard of Care chemotherapy (squamous patients only)

DRUG

Pemetrexed+carboplatin

Standard of Care chemotherapy (non-squamous patients only)

DRUG

Gemcitabine+cisplatin

Standard of Care chemotherapy (squamous patients only)

DRUG

Pemetrexed+cisplatin

Standard of Care chemotherapy (non-squamous patients only)
